16 months

Well since time flew by and my "15 month" post never happened, 16 months will do. Evie is 16 months and definitely becoming more Toddler and MUCH less Baby (tear). It is crazy that it is hard to even remember when she would just be content laying on her play mat and just stare at her animals--not so anymore! She is always on the GO and truly NEVER stops. She is definitely curious and mischievous I would say. One minute she is ripping our wallpaper off, the next she is tearing every pot and pan out of the cabinet, and the next she is pulling out all of my shoes from the closet. Yes, most days the only thing I can say I did for the day is chased after her trying to not let her destroy the house! Here are some other things she has been up to:
  • She is being very stubborn in the "word" picking up--she understands pretty well but refuses to repeat or try to sound new words. She says "mom", "daddy", "doggie", "hi", "ball", "baby", "baa" and a monkey sound. I think I just attribute it to her stubborn nature. 
  • She definitely throws fits--a lot! I can even call it before it is about to happen. They do make me laugh a little as it is cute in an odd way.
  • She still is in the 50th percentile--weight and height, with still a round little baby belly (the one thing I got left)
  • She does know a lot of her body parts and can point to about any one we say
  • Picky, picky, picky--when it comes to food I mean. She LOVES pasta and will eat chicken and hotdogs, maybe some fruit here or there but vegetables usually get tossed on the floor (yes we are working on that).
  • Oh yes we have instigated "time-outs" as we have learned "no" has NO affect on this child. We are still trying to figure all that "discipline" stuff out as I know she understands a lot but not everything. 
  • It is the era of "EHH"---all I hear ALL DAY LONG. Kinda ready for some more words, it's not easy being a sleuth all day trying to figure you out.
  • Evie has decided she wants to be attached to me---WAY attached to me. She used to be very independent but not so much anymore. Although when there are people around and the attention is on her, she is always soaking up every bit!
  • She still is an outside girl and give her a pile of rocks and she will be amused for hours! She also loves to go to the park and climb on everything!
  • She also has become quite a CHEF! She gets pretty upset if I don't let her help me cook so don't be surprised if she has a cookbook out soon!






Well she definitely keeps us on our toes but we couldn't love that little girl anymore! We are truly blessed to be her parents!
